The Asset Tag Market is strongly influenced by the wide range of applications that rely on accurate asset identification and tracking to maintain operational efficiency. Across industries, asset tags are used to monitor physical assets throughout their lifecycle, from acquisition and deployment to maintenance and disposal. These applications address critical business challenges such as asset loss, inefficiency, compliance risks, and high operational costs, making asset tagging a strategic investment rather than a basic operational tool.
One of the most prominent applications of asset tagging is in inventory and warehouse management. Warehouses handle large volumes of goods and equipment, often across multiple facilities. Asset tags enable real-time tracking of inventory levels, asset movement, and storage locations. This improves order fulfillment accuracy, reduces misplaced items, and supports just-in-time inventory practices. By providing visibility into asset utilization, organizations can optimize storage layouts and reduce carrying costs.
Healthcare is another major application area where asset tags play a vital role. Hospitals and clinics manage a vast array of medical equipment, ranging from infusion pumps and diagnostic devices to wheelchairs and hospital beds. Asset tagging allows healthcare providers to quickly locate equipment, schedule maintenance, and ensure compliance with safety regulations. This not only improves operational efficiency but also enhances patient care by ensuring that critical equipment is available when needed.
Information technology asset management represents a growing application segment for asset tags. Organizations rely heavily on IT equipment such as servers, laptops, networking devices, and peripherals. Asset tags help track these items across their lifecycle, manage software licensing, and support audits. In data centers, asset tagging improves rack-level visibility and helps prevent unauthorized equipment removal, which is critical for security and compliance.
In manufacturing environments, asset tags are used to track machinery, tools, and work-in-progress items. By tagging production equipment, manufacturers can monitor usage patterns, schedule preventive maintenance, and reduce unplanned downtime. Asset tags also support lean manufacturing initiatives by improving workflow visibility and reducing waste. In complex production environments, RFID-based tags enable automated data collection without interrupting operations.
The construction industry has increasingly adopted asset tagging to manage tools, heavy equipment, and materials across multiple job sites. Construction assets are often mobile and exposed to harsh environments, making them susceptible to loss and damage. Durable asset tags help contractors track asset location, prevent theft, and ensure that the right equipment is available at each site. This improves project timelines and reduces replacement costs.
Retail applications of asset tagging extend beyond inventory control to include loss prevention and omnichannel operations. Asset tags help retailers monitor high-value items, reduce shrinkage, and manage stock across physical and online channels. By integrating asset tagging with point-of-sale and inventory systems, retailers can provide accurate stock availability information to customers, improving satisfaction and sales performance.
Government and public sector organizations also rely on asset tagging for accountability and transparency. Asset tags are used to track vehicles, office equipment, infrastructure components, and defense assets. Accurate asset records support budgeting, maintenance planning, and compliance with audit requirements. In public sector environments, asset tagging contributes to responsible resource management and reduced misuse of taxpayer-funded assets.
Transportation and logistics applications further highlight the versatility of asset tags. Logistics providers use tags to track containers, pallets, and vehicles across supply chains. This improves shipment visibility, reduces delays, and supports condition monitoring for sensitive goods. Asset tagging also plays a role in fleet management, where it helps monitor vehicle usage, maintenance schedules, and regulatory compliance.@https://www.marketresearchfuture.com/reports/asset-tag-market-35429
